The purpose of this role is to provide financial and project related support to a Construction and Highways office who specialise in Civil Engineering. The role will involve working with a range of internal staff including operatives, procurement and commercial. The position requires methodical attention to detail and the successful candidate will be working to stringent deadlines.

Location

This role will be based in our Killingworth office, within North Tyneside. However, travelling may be required to other Capita offices or Client offices.

What you’ll be doing:

SAP/Desktop Housekeeping

  • Monthly assistance with the inputting/maintenance of project forecasts in liaison with Project Managers
  • Run project reports for effective budget management of construction and highway projects .
  • Complete project closures in our in house Desktop system.
  • Raise invoices on behalf of project managers (adhoc, as and when required)
  • Manage the recording and procurement of operatives personal protective equipment (PPE)
  • Procurement

  • Create purchase orders in SAP system and make any necessary amendments
  • Manage the ‘goods receipt’ spreadsheet for effective invoicing.
  • Manage supplier statements to ensure correct and timely payment is completed
  • Monitor supplier invoices via our in house Ebydos system
  • Run regular purchase order reports for the finance manager
  • Manage our on site stock of materials (including the data input into the SAP system)
